The track from the mameworld site is a CD quality reproduction of the original loop tape. The loop tape is a little different from the album version, and the creator took the time to cut and paste the album waveform to match the loop tape. I can't verify that it's accurate since I don't have a loop tape, but if someone went to all that trouble, I would think it's pretty close.

Ok everyone here is the scoop... The version from MAME is correct.

I have been a radio DJ all my life and have mixed and remixed tons and tons of stuff over the years - so this didnt take too long.

First I recorded the track into my computer from the tape... SOUNDED HORRIBLE!!!

The total length of the tape is 3 minutes... then there is a 2 1/2 second pause and the track starts again. The track itself has two major edits (as far as time) They are right in the beginning of the track (16 counts of instrumental is cut out) and then following the first chorus there is another 16 counts cut out.

Office Max sells 6 minute endless loop tapes... I simply doubled the edited track and made it 6 minutes (all digital) and now all I have to do is record it onto the new endless loop tape and put on the label. Done deal.

The first picture is the original tape - the second is some of my replacement labels.

The track is NOT live...
